The BMI USA 4167 is a lead-free brass threaded nipple designed for use in plumbing and fluid distribution systems. Measuring 1/8 inch in diameter and 7 inches in length, this nipple connects two female-threaded fittings or serves as an extension between threaded components. Its brass construction provides corrosion resistance and durability in both hot and cold water applications. The lead-free designation makes it suitable for potable water systems where compliance with current safe drinking water standards is required. Licensed plumbers and pipefitters are the primary installers of this type of fitting.
This nipple is suited for residential and light commercial plumbing installations where a 1/8-inch threaded connection is needed. Common applications include water supply lines, distribution manifolds, and branch connections in tight-space installations. The 7-inch length provides additional reach where close nipples or short nipples are not sufficient. The red finish aids in quick visual identification during installation and inspection.
Designed as an OEM-style replacement or standard component for 1/8-inch NPT threaded plumbing systems in residential and light commercial applications.
Installation should be performed by a licensed plumber in accordance with applicable local plumbing codes and the International Plumbing Code (IPC). Shut off the water supply and relieve system pressure before removing or installing any threaded fitting. Apply thread sealant tape or pipe dope to the male threads before assembly to ensure a leak-free connection. Do not overtighten, as brass threads can be damaged by excessive torque.
